San Sebastián will host in October the trial for the death by torture of PNV militant Txomin Letamendi

World 1 source 1 country 🔦 Under-reported 45m ago

A trial concerning the 1950 death of Txomin Letamendi, a PNV militant and intelligence agent for exiled Lehendakari José Antonio Agirre, is scheduled for October 6 in San Sebastián. Letamendi died in Madrid as a result of alleged torture during the Francoist period. The proceedings represent the first judicial action of its kind under Spain's Law 20/2022 on Democratic Memory. The case marks a significant legal development in addressing historical grievances related to the Franco regime.
